Analysis
The most recent figure for singapore —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— export in Pakistan is 198 t, measured in 2018.
The figure is down 83.7% on the previous year and up 800.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, singapore —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— export in Pakistan peaked at 1,215 t in 2017 and was at its lowest, 1 t, in 1998.
Pakistan ranks 27th of 53 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
